GROUP SALES MANAGER POSITION PROFILE Reports To: Director of Sales - Position is Exempt WHO WE ARE The Heathman is Portland's magnet for artistic minds. Since 1927, the Heathman's unique atmosphere of cultured comfort has served as a muse for artists, creators, collaborators, thinkers, dreamers and doers. With its prime placement in Portland's cultural district, the Heathman is distinguished by reputation as a discerning retreat for the global citizen, and a haven for creative inspiration. Hearthman Hotel is managed by Aparium Hotels. Aparium was founded in 2011 to bring lifestyle service and accommodations to underserved yet distinct and important cities while maintaining and celebrating the unadulterated character of each. Responsibilities

  • Uphold and role model the company's principles of People, Place and Character; and ensure your team and peers are also modeling the way of our values that drive collaboration, intuition and translocal hospitality
  • Build and maintain a trusting and transparent relationship with all stakeholders, specifically taking the time to develop rapport and respect with the individuals of your peer group within the Leadership Team.
  • Understand who the hotel is and what we aspire to be by following established practices and procedures; and projects the appropriate brand voice and image of each hotel to achieve objectives, public recognition, and acceptance
  • Lead and direct the sales department in developing and executing the sales and marketing plan and refine their revenue forecasting; provide creative strategies to positively influence sales initiatives that drive revenue helping teams achieve their goals
  • Coach your fellow Leadership Team Members by collaboratively helping them creatively solve problems when challenges arise; ensure the team receives the necessary learning and development to grow within their roles whether is functional training or soft skill development activities
  • Clever in maximizing hotel revenue through effective pricing strategies for transient or group inventory, which is done by analyzing sales statistics against booked vs. consumed business; and having an educated understanding of the local market to determine client needs, occupancy potential, and desired rates
  • Pivot short-term strategy to compensate for short-term needs, without compromising long-term goals, such as placing business on the books in the fourth quarter, without losing focus on the first quarter and gaining traction on long-term goals
  • Establish regular and frequent communication with Aparium Headquarters to ensure initiatives are executed within the hotel marketing plan; champion the need for thorough and accurate reporting and forecasting to develop an informative database of business to identify needs, trends and gaps that will create better booking decisions
  • Craft and establish the annual sales goals, ensuring they are fully understood and implemented in the hotel; collect and maintain proper documentation of incentive worksheets to document achievements, which is best in the market
  • Direct the reporting and apprising of results against planned objectives; coordinates sales associate activities; takes appropriate action to maximize sales and affect need periods
  • Develop the annual budget and sales + marketing plan in collaboration with the General Manager and Controller, ensuring the department operates within cost constraints, achieves yield management goals; ensures proper market mix, group room rate, and average rate goals
  • Evaluates, solicits, sells and confirms business in assigned market area to meet overall budgeted sales and profitability, control dates, availability, and rates on guest rooms and function space
